How to Identify Reliable News Sources
With the proliferation of online content, distinguishing reliable news sources is critical. Look for transparency in sourcing, clear author credentials, and a history of factual reporting. Cross-referencing information across multiple platforms can help verify accuracy. Always prioritize outlets that adhere to journalistic ethics and avoid sensationalism.

The Role of Social Media in News Discovery
Social media platforms like Twitter and Facebook have become significant news hubs. However, they often prioritize engagement over accuracy, increasing the risk of misinformation. Users should approach these channels cautiously, verifying claims through reliable news sources before sharing them.
Fact-Checking and Verifying Online News
Fact-checking is vital in an era of rapid information dissemination. Tools like Snopes and FactCheck.org help debunk myths, while browser extensions flag dubious content. Always cross-reference headlines with multiple reliable news sources to ensure credibility.
Privacy Concerns When Reading News Online
Reading news online often involves data collection by publishers and advertisers. Users should review privacy policies, use ad blockers, and avoid sharing personal information unnecessarily. Opting for platforms with strong encryption and minimal tracking enhances online safety.

Tips for Staying Informed Without Information Overload
- Set daily limits on news consumption to avoid burnout and focus on quality over quantity.
- Follow a mix of reliable news sources to gain balanced perspectives on current events.
- Use tools like RSS feeds or newsletters to consolidate updates from multiple platforms efficiently.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Reading News Online
- Sharing unverified content without checking its source can spread misinformation.
- Overreliance on a single news app or outlet may limit exposure to diverse viewpoints.
- Ignoring privacy settings can compromise personal data, especially on free news platforms.
